BMS Digital Safety: Common Threats and How to Prevent Them
Building management platforms (BMS) are progressively reliant on online connectivity, which introduces a number of digital threats . Common incidents include ransomware infections, BMS Digital Safety unauthorized intrusion via unsecured passwords, and fraudulent schemes designed to obtain sensitive data . To prevent these issues, it’s critical to establish robust safeguards such as frequent software patches , strong password policies , multi-factor authorization, and personnel training on online security best practices. Furthermore, segmenting the BMS infrastructure from other organizational networks and undertaking routine penetration assessments are key steps to protect your facility from online harm.
